Case summary

On January 17, 2002, the U.S. District Court, Northern District of California, entered a consent decree in the matter of United States v. The Santos/Alviso Partnership, L.P., et al., case no. CV-11-4139, regarding the South Bay Asbestos Superfund Site in San Jose, California. The decree required institutional controls for the Santos Landfill portion of the Superfund Site, at which asbestos contaminated waste has been buried underground. The institutional controls consist of putting in place deed restrictions and operation and maintenance requirements to ensure that a soil cover (at least two feet thick in depth) remains intact and is inspected and maintained by the present and future owners of the subject property. The defendants in the case recorded the deed restriction on September 14, 2011. The settlement did not involve the recovery of response costs of the United States. The value of the restrictions placed on the property in question are estimated to be $0.
